The interview process was straightforward, starting with a Zoom call with the manager and PI. Afterwards, I visited the site for a second interview where I met the team and toured the facility. I was in touch with the hiring manager and administration throughout the entire hiring process.

We hire mainly through the UMass HR website. You'll get an email with an interview invite. Some PIs do a phone interview first, others prefer an in-person. To be fair, we ask everyone the same questions. Everyone involved in hiring fills out an evaluation form after the interview. The person with the best score gets the job.

first interview was a ~30 minute long zoom call with the PI where she asked standard questions about my work experience. I was surprised that she asked me a few math-related questions that related to making solutions and other lab-related tasks. the next round was a full day of in-person meetings with people from the lab as well as other labs within the department.
